Literally translating to 'best face' in Korean, the term ulzzang has become a popular cultural phenomenon, representing the quintessential South Korean beauty ideal. This style is often characterized by large eyes, a petite mouth, a high nose bridge, and fair skin, reminiscent of Korean models. The ulzzang trend gained traction through photo contests on the social media platform Cyworld, where users voted for the most attractive photos.
